### Understanding Bitcoin
Before we dive into how to buy bitcoin, it’s essential to understand what bitcoin is. Bitcoin is a decentralized digital currency that allows for peer-to-peer transactions without the need for intermediaries like banks. It’s the first decentralized cryptocurrency and has been gaining popularity over the years.

### How to Buy Bitcoin: Step-by-Step Guide
#### Step 1: Choose a Bitcoin Wallet
The first step in buying bitcoin is to choose a bitcoin wallet. A bitcoin wallet is where you’ll store your bitcoin once you’ve purchased it. There are several types of bitcoin wallets, including desktop wallets, mobile wallets, and online wallets. Do some research and choose a wallet that’s right for you.
#### Step 2: Find a Bitcoin Exchange
Once you’ve chosen a bitcoin wallet, you’ll need to find a bitcoin exchange. A bitcoin exchange is where you’ll buy your bitcoin. There are several bitcoin exchanges to choose from, including Coinbase, Kraken, and Bitfinex. Do some research and find an exchange that’s reputable and has low fees.
#### Step 3: Buy Bitcoin
Now that you have a bitcoin wallet and a bitcoin exchange, it’s time to buy bitcoin. To do this, you’ll need to deposit money into your exchange account using a payment method such as a debit card or bank transfer. Once the money is deposited, you can use it to buy bitcoin. Follow the exchange’s instructions to complete the purchase
#### Step 4: Store Your Bitcoin
Once you’ve purchased your bitcoin, it’s essential to store it safely. This means transferring it from the exchange to your bitcoin wallet. Make sure to use a secure internet connection and two-factor authentication to prevent hacking.
